SnoaL-like polyketide cyclase; This family includes SnoaL a polyketide cyclase involved in nogalamycin biosynthesis. This family was formerly known as DUF1486. The proteins in this family adopt a distorted alpha-beta barrel fold. Structural data together with site-directed mutagenesis experiments have shown that SnoaL has a different mechanism to that of the classical aldolase for catalysing intramolecular aldol condensation.
